Our careers programme is an integral part of our curriculum and has a real impact on our pupils’ long-term outcomes.  We measure and assess this impact via student survey, monitoring event attendance and by regularly compiling event specific feedback from pupils, parents, employers, teachers and further education providers.  We have good communication links with our local further education and training providers and keep in touch regarding pupil outcomes, providing support where we can.

Year 10 Experience College Life at Selby College

Year 10 students recently took part in a College Experience Day at Selby College, where they tried out different subject taster sessions and got a real feel for what college life is like. The day helped pupils understand the opportunities available after leaving The Snaith School and supported them in thinking about their post-16 choices and life beyond school, while also helping students build their independence and confidence in a new environment.

National Apprenticeship Week and National Careers Week 2026

We celebrated National Apprenticeship Week and National Careers Week with a range of engaging assemblies and activities designed to raise awareness of future pathways and opportunities. As part of the celebrations, students across Year 8, 9 and 10 benefited from valuable sessions delivered by Selby College and York College. These provided insight into technical and vocational learning, as well as the wide range of study and career options available at post-16 and post-18.

Celotex Visit

A group of Year 7 pupils had an exciting and insightful visit to the Celotex manufacturing facility, offering them a unique opportunity to see how industry-leading insulation materials are designed, produced and tested.
